Abstract

The aim of the project was to contribute to an initial assessment of the potential economic benefits of enhanced transboundary cooperation on the Kura river and of the costs generated by a non-coordinated approach. Finally, recommendations for a pragmatic implementation of an improved water management were forwarded to the government and administration of Azerbaijan and Georgia.
